Christmas Chocolate Cookies (Printable Version)

Holiday chocolate chip treats full of rich chocolate and festive flavors.

# Ingredients You'll Need:

→ Dry stuff

01 - 1 teaspoon salt
02 - 281 grams plain flour
03 - 1 teaspoon baking soda

→ Wet stuff

04 - 2 big eggs
05 - 227 grams softened unsalted butter
06 - 1 teaspoon vanilla
07 - 150 grams white sugar
08 - 165 grams packed brown sugar

→ Extras

09 - 150 grams red and green M&M's (you can skip these)
10 - 340 grams semi-sweet chocolate chips

# Detailed Preparation Steps:

01 - Heat oven to 190°C. Put parchment on your baking pans.
02 - Take a medium bowl and stir together flour, baking soda, and salt.
03 - In a big bowl, mix the butter with both sugars and vanilla till it's creamy.
04 - Beat in eggs one by one. Then slowly mix in the dry stuff till combined.
05 - Gently fold in chocolate chips and candies so they're spread out evenly.
06 - Use a spoon to put dough mounds on pans about 5 cm apart.
07 - Bake for 9 to 11 minutes until edges are golden. Let cool before eating.

# Helpful Tips:

01 - To get softer cookies, pull them out just before they look done. Keep in a sealed container for up to five days.
02 - Feel free to swap chocolate chips or add nuts for a change.
